Wheel power

Joglekar aims to find an entry into Limca Book of Records some day.

A resident of Chinchwad,Jayant Prabhakar Joglekar recently drove to Kanyakumari on his motorbike and back,a journey of 3058 kms,which he completed in 99 hours. Ecstatic about his achievement,57-year-old Joglekar,who has been working with Tata Motors from the past 33 years,admits that he did face a few challenges during his trip. “At times,I almost gave up but then told myself that I should not quit,” he says. The route of his trip was Pune- Bengluru-Madurai- Kanyakumari- Madurai- Bangalore- Pune. It is not the first time that Joglekar covered a long distance on his bike. In July last year,he covered Delhi-Chandigarh-Simla- Manali- Rohtang Pass- Leh (Ladakh) in 57 hours and 15 minutes. Joglekar aims to find an entry into Limca Book of Records some day.
